The Energy Challenge: More Demand, Smarter Solutions
The United States is experiencing an unprecedented surge in electricity demand. Factors like industrial onshoring, the rapid electrification of transportation, and the explosive growth of artificial intelligence are pushing our power infrastructure to its limits. Traditional energy systems are struggling to keep up, creating a critical need for innovative solutions.

How It Works: The Tech Behind the Innovation
At the heart of this collaboration is Carrier’s Home Energy Management System (HEMS), a sophisticated technology that transforms how residential HVAC systems interact with the electrical grid. By integrating Google Cloud’s advanced AI analytics and WeatherNext AI models, the system can now do something remarkable: predict, adapt, and optimize energy consumption in real-time.
Here’s what that means for the average homeowner:
- Battery Storage Magic: Your home becomes a mini power station. During low-demand periods, the system stores electricity in batteries.
- Peak Demand Optimization: When electricity prices spike, your home can switch to stored battery power, potentially saving you significant money.
- Weather-Smart Operations: Google’s AI models factor in weather predictions to make your HVAC system incredibly efficient, reducing unnecessary energy consumption.
The Bigger Picture: Climate and Economic Impact
This isn’t just about individual homes – it’s about transforming our entire energy ecosystem. Carrier has an ambitious goal of helping its customers avoid more than one gigaton of greenhouse gas emissions by 2030. By creating a more flexible, intelligent grid, they’re taking a massive step toward that target.
“Across the country, we see an opportunity to build resilience in communities and scale innovative, clean energy solutions that foster economic growth,” says Caroline Golin, Google’s global head of Energy Market Development and Innovation.

A Phased Approach to Nationwide Transformation
The rollout is strategic. Starting now and continuing through 2027, Carrier and Google Cloud will gradually implement this technology, focusing on creating scalable benefits for local energy markets. The long-term vision? A nationwide network of smart, interconnected homes that collectively contribute to grid stability.
